Output 8499303dbaba0646bdb05b8a7ddb772686f5480a833926aa71dee256ffe94e8b:4

value
53825550
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f46585639b7cbf991c056c2b31c6f23a90410891 OP_EQUAL
address
MWBQj3TFxbkqRiXGV6TJGeuDat3p7ASdiM
transaction
8499303dbaba0646bdb05b8a7ddb772686f5480a833926aa71dee256ffe94e8b
spent
true